Job Summary

This role focuses on the design and development of advanced audio signal processing algorithms specifically for next-generation hearing implants. As a key member of the R&D team, you will be responsible for implementing these algorithms on ultra-low-power hardware platforms while creating and optimizing measurement setups to validate performance. A significant portion of the role involves fine-tuning algorithms for optimal audio quality and ensuring all technical documentation meets strict medical device standards. This position is particularly attractive for those looking to work on life-changing medical technology within a flexible 38.5-hour work week. You will bridge the gap between theoretical signal processing and practical hardware implementation, making it an ideal role for a specialist who enjoys both high-level algorithm development and hands-on embedded programming.
